I'm new to bow hunting and just bought a used Golden Eagle. Most of the model numbers are rubbed off. but the rest of the specs are there.
27-31 draw length, 55-70 lbs, and it had h-5 (30" i believe) mods in it. I need to drop it to 28". Escalade sports wants me to send them the bow, because there isn't a dealer in over 100 miles of where i live. that would just be too much cost for an old bow.

My question is does anybody have the mods for sale or know the mod number I need (h2?) and an online dealer i can order them from. Escalade Sport refuses to mail them out.

All those old GEs ran very long on the draw length. This was typical in that era. You'll need a H1 or H2 to get it down to an AMO 28".
